Interesting about the paint. Looked at probably 15 white ‘14’ and ‘64’ plate ex-DPD vans yesterday and they were all developing rust on the external bodywork pretty much at random. Nothing that threatens the structural parts but enough that the game of ‘whack-a-mole’ has already begun. Will go and look at some non-white ones.
